Description
This book will support children as they:
* Find out about wartime phrases and use them to write a dialogue
* Write a letter home from a P.O.W. camp
* Read wartime adverts and slogans and decide how effective they are

Content
Part I: Source materials and activities, Evacuee children (I), Evacuee children (2), Evacuee children (3), Everyday life in wartime, The need for shelters, Wireless lessons, Civilian safety, News reports, Speak like an RAF Officer! Salvage, Rationing and the black market, Delicious dishes? Advertising in wartime, Careless talk costs lives, Make do and mend, Doctor Carrot and Potato Pete, The Squander Bug, Women at war, Wartime Christmas, Occupied Britain, The Welsh Great Escape, VE Day and VE Day celebrations, Part 2: Anthology, The day war broke out, Evacuation of children from the Channel Islands, The end of evacuation 1939-40, From an advert for wool, Salvage Song (or, The Housewife's Dream), Salvage rhymes, I've Finished My Black-out, (The Song of a Triumphant Housewife), Dig for Victory, A song sung by the Women's Land Army, (Land Girls), Women working in factories, War rhymes, Song of the pilots in the Second World War, Second World War memories, The Channel Islands: Guernsey, The Channel Islands: A letter to Father Christmas, The Channel Islands: Wartime recipes, Interview: Mrs Ivy Green, Ramsgate, Friend or Foe, One man's war, Notes on anthology selections
